I tend to look at my knives as bushcraft/wilderness blades.

The scrapper 6 is my favorite all around multipurpose do everything knife. There isn't much I cannot do with it. It doesn't excell at any one thing but it does most everything pretty decently. It's currently my go to blade and sits in a Spec-Ops survival sheath. The Scrapper 7 may replace the scrapper 6 when it comes out.

The SS4 is a very practical blade size. I find that I use it for a lot of everyday task. It's an easy blade to manipulate and it earns a lot of use from me. Infi, in my opinion is perfect for knives like these. However, since it smaller it's uses get more specific.

The Dogfather is a beast of a blade. It specalizes in chopping. And while there's nothing wrong with a pure chopper it takes a hit in other areas because of its size and heft. This blade is best paired with the SS4 or similar blade.
